The special services could liberate Kramatorsk, Luhansk and Slavyansk in the spring of 2014 - the minister

The Minister of Veteran Affairs, Yulia Laputina, said that in 2014, Ukrainian special services and the military could liberate Slavyansk, Kramatorsk, and Luhansk at the early stage of the Anti-Terrorist Operation. Laputina stated this in an interview "Interfax-Ukraine«

 "At that moment, when Hyrkin really did not have a more or less significant power reserve, and there was still time before the entry of Russian troops, right at the Kramatorsk airport, our employees developed a plan to encircle Slavyansk. After all, our military was stationed on the side of Izyum, and special operations forces were stationed on the other side of this airfield. The plan was the following: to arm and equip forces at the Kramatorsk airfield. Further, the force of the strike group from the positions of Kramatorsk and those troops who were standing on the side of Izyum will surround Slavyansk and work out the terrorists in sectors. But this plan was not accepted."

The acting minister, who herself participated in the defense of the Kramatorsk airfield, suggests that they could simply not inform the leadership at the level of the minister of defense and above about this plan.

According to her, there was an opportunity in early April 2014 to liberate Luhansk as well. Then the special services were also ready to storm the captured surrenders, but they were not given the command.

Also, the security forces offered to neutralize the organizers of the seizure of the Crimean parliament, but "the people who then took responsibility for the country in such a difficult period lacked willpower and firmness."

Let us remind you that the Ukrainian armed forces liberated Slavyansk and Kramatorsk in July 2014. Before that, since April 2014, the city was under the control of illegal armed forces.
